Asphalt Plant Groundsperson/Laborer

Location: Ashland, KY, US, 41101 Company: Mountain Enterprises Inc The Mountain Companies, comprised of Mountain Enterprises, Mountain Materials, and Mountain Aggregates, have been providing asphalt paving and aggregate services to the state of Kentucky for decades. By being a part of the CRH family, we are a proud reflection of the hundreds of family businesses, local and regional companies and mid to large sized enterprises that come together to form CRH. Primary Function

This position will perform various duties around the asphalt plant that include but are not limited to; general laboring, equipment operation, and plant maintenance. This position will report directly to the Plant Manager. Position Requirements

The selected candidate will be required to work in a team environment with other co-workers and managers; Perform minor servicing and maintenance on plant equipment as needed, using ladders to access platforms, and landings; Safely and efficiently operate heavy equipment such as bobcat, skid steer loader, and wash down hose; Report any problems to your manager; When working with co-workers, constant eye contact will be maintained when backing, communicating using hand signals or other movements; Other miscellaneous duties include but not limited to; general labor, shoveling, performing necessary equipment maintenance, assisting foreperson and/or crew members as needed; May perform welding and fabrication duties as required; Ability to detect safety hazards and equipment malfunctions and respond accordingly; Ability to follow directions, both written and oral; Properly follow all company policies and OSHA/MSHA regulations for safe working procedures and environment; Follow directions of Foreman as to daily tasks and expectations for each specific project or jobsite; Perform daily pre-and-post inspections with appropriate documentation in compliance with company policies; Assist in training less-experienced employees on the proper operations, servicing, and repair of equipment to further their abilities; and Perform other duties as assigned. Minimum Qualifications

Pass pre-employment drug screen and criminal background check; Pass a pre-employment "Fit for Work" physical; Be able to provide valid documentation for the I-9 Immigration document; Display a professional and courteous attitude to co-workers, supervisors, and the general public at all times; Willing to travel and work away from home when required; Be willing to work nights and weekends when necessary; Report to work at the designated start time; Be able to work overtime when required; Be willing to work outdoors in extreme temperatures, both hot and cold; Strictly adhere to safety requirements and procedures as outlined in the Employee Handbook; Have the willingness to work in a team environment and assist co-workers or supervisors with other duties as required; Wear personal protective equipment (PPE) in designated operations and production areas as stated by OSHA and/or MSHA; Be at least age 18 years of age due to nature of working environment; Minimum high school diploma or general education degree (GED) required; and Previous related experience in the construction field and/or training.
